You go through an office building to get to this restaurant. In fact, a part of the office building has been retrofitted to create this restaurant inside. Nicely done.However, when you look at some parts on the ceiling, you are reminded that this is an office building.Overall, it’s a very good experience all around. Is it worth the cost? That’s debatable.Instead of bread, they serve pita bread pieces alongside vinegar sauce, oil infused with cheese and melt in your mouth garlic cloves - very tender.If you’re ok going for a non-alcoholic drink, I would recommend the Pineapple ginger.Buttermilk calamari recommended for appetizer.For the meal, we ordered ketchup today which was mahi-mahi. Surprisingly pretty spicy actually but very flavorful at the same time.We also had filet mignon which was juicy inside and crusted on the outside.All in all, this place is definitely worth a try one time.

Finally got to try this place - and I have to say, I haven’t had a great restaurant first visit experience like this in awhile!!!I went on a date here with my boyfriend and we wanted to go somewhere a little extra special. We have heard great things about CityGate from our friends who also live nearby. I have to say, I was a little skeptical walking up to the place seeing that it was inside of the Calamos Investment building, it just threw me off, but that said, we were pleasantly surprised at how beautiful and elegant the inside of the restaurant felt. It felt kind of exclusive.We came in a Friday night and we were treated to some live jazz. My boyfriend and I both said we felt like we were on vacation. Some couples got up and slow danced together which was sweet and fun to watch. But I have to say, my favorite thing about this place is the warm pita bread with roasted garlic cloves,olive oil, and fresh parmesan cheese - it was absolutely delicious and a pleasant/unique twist to being served fresh bread and butter at the beginning of a meal. I recreated this at home a couple of times.Our waitress was knowledgeable and attentive and the wine selection was excellent. Our steak was a 10/10.We have returned multiple times since our first experience and each time is truly a treat!

This is a great looking venue. It provides live music on Friday and Saturday evenings. The music is generally jazz or popular played at a level which will not interfere with your dining experience. There is a small dance floor which allows for some limited dancing. It really isn't the place to go for dancing but, it is not discouraged. The food is outstanding as is the service.

Me and my Husband visited on 2-17-24 they were highlighting a local jazz musician Harold Dawson. The first drawback no valet parking and the save adjacent to the restaurant had about 20 spaces so we had to park in the parking garage which wasn't to far but if you have on a cute heel or bad weather. Once inside the restaurant was beautiful once seated away from where we requested to be seated where we could see the musician . The noise level was overbearing from the other guest. The service staff was informative and attentive . Now to the food I ordered the Basil salmon with whipped potatoes and garlic spinach. My husband ordered the chicken with whipped potatoes. The food was okay my spinach was too salty. Oh I forgot the underwhelming crab cake appetizer and the pita bread with oil and garlic which didn't match the restaurant menu at all where was the warm bread I was confused by this one for sure. The drinks were good I ordered the city gate rum punch and my husband ordered the Oishi old fashion which he said smelled fragrant but didn't have any taste. We wanted dessert but the waiter gave us the honest opinion that the cake was dry and the other options weren't too our liking. Let me not forget the bathroom isn't located in the restaurant which was shocking to walk down a flight of stairs by the emergency exit. Oh and coat check misplaced my husband coat took them 5 minutes to locate. Overall I'd return if there's music and I could get my requested seat.
